Contrary to popular belief, the ability to fix closed eyes in a photo is not a new phenomenon. In fact, it dates back to the early days of photography when retouchers manually painted over closed eyes to open them in printed images. This painstaking process required skilled artists who meticulously manipulated the prints to create the desired effect.
In today's digital age, advancements in technology have made the process far more accessible and efficient. With the emergence of photo editing apps and AI-powered tools, anyone can fix closed eyes in a photo on iPhone with just a few taps.

Going Deeper: Exploring the Process of Fixing Closed Eyes in a Photo on iPhone
Now that you have a basic understanding of how to fix closed eyes in a photo on iPhone, let's dive deeper into the topic.
When it comes to fixing closed eyes in a photo, there are several factors to consider. Lighting, facial expressions, and the overall composition of the image can all impact the success of the correction. It's important to take these elements into account and make any necessary adjustments before applying the eye correction tool.
Additionally, it's worth noting that while AI-powered tools can provide impressive results, they are not perfect. In some cases, the tool may struggle to detect closed eyes accurately or may produce results that appear unnatural. As a photographer, it's essential to review and fine-tune the corrections to ensure the final image looks seamless and realistic.
